MechWarrior Online World Championships Announced

Posted: 05 Apr 2016 04:22 PM PDT

Piranha Games announced today that signups are now open for the qualifying rounds of the highest skill tournament in eSports, the MechWarrior Online World Championships for 2016. With more than $100,000 dollars up for grabs, eligible teams can sign up now at http://mwomercs.com/mwowc2016 for the regional qualifying rounds which will begin this May. The regional finals will take place this fall, with the MechWarrior Online World Championships taking place on December 3rd in Vancouver at the Commodore Ballroom at the first ever "Mech Con."

With more than 10 million+ matches already played via several regionally placed servers, pilots can train on more than 19 different maps and 350+ available Mechs to choose from in a neverending variety of configurations. New pilots are also offered a complete tutorial experience in the MechWarrior Academy to familiarize themselves with the competitive aspects of MechWarrior Online. With an incredibly active community engaged in providing feedback to the developers, MechWarrior Online has become the most complete MechWarrior multiplayer experience ever available.

Find out if you and your teammates have what it takes in the most competitive MechWarrior Online environments: Go head to head with your team of eight pilots and coordinate, strategize and conquer your way to Vancouver this year. The official website for the MechWarrior Online World Championships 2016 has details on all team construction rules, tournament structure, gameplay rules and prize distribution for The Championships in December. Tickets will go on sale in May.

Full Mech Con details will be released later this year but eager pilots looking to be a part of the ultimate MechWarrior event in the franchise's 20+ year history, fraternize with the enemy and forge new alliances will want to attend. Attendees will also be able to grab prizes, enjoy live music, experience the tournament finals and be the first to hear announcements at the ultimate MechWarrior Online event that will be livestreamed around the globe on December 3rd.

Grinding Gear Games & Tencent Partner to Bring Path of Exile to China

Posted: 05 Apr 2016 03:50 PM PDT

Grinding Gear Games recently announced at the Tencent Interactive Entertainment 2016 Annual Press Conference in Beijing that the two companies will work together to bring critically acclaimed action RPG Path of Exile to players in Mainland China. Tencent is China’s leading provider of Internet value added services, providing unparalleled access and reach for Path of Exile in the world’s largest gaming market.

Path of Exile will be available in simplified Chinese with servers based in China. The Chinese servers will operate within a separate realm that will not be connected to the game’s international realm. Existing Chinese players on Grinding Gear Games servers can opt to continue playing on GGG servers or start playing on the Chinese Tencent servers, whichever they prefer. The first Chinese Alpha test is scheduled to begin in May 2016.

Visit Tencent’s Path of Exile site for additional information.

Duelyst Launch Date Announced

Posted: 05 Apr 2016 02:46 PM PDT

Duelyst, the collectible tactics game from Counterplay Games, will officially launch on April 27, 2016. Duelyst brings together the depth of tactical combat with the endless possibilities of collectible card games, offering players a fresh new experience. Matches last between five and ten minutes, focusing on thoughtful decision-making and rewarding players with new battle units every regular season.

Duelyst is trailing a path in the gaming community, with its popularity spreading to both professional and amateur gamers during the game's Open Beta as a Top Most Played on Twitch during peak hours. The Duelyst Beta community continues to grow with more than 150,000 matches played every day.

"Our goal for Duelyst is to be compelling at the highest levels of play while remaining accessible to brand new players," said Keith Lee, CEO of Counterplay Games. "Part of that strategy is to offer gamers short bursts of play along a smooth skill-curve so that players can invest in the long term metagame for many years to come."

Duelyst is accessible to all players by offering various competitive modes including Solo Challenges, Practice against computer-controlled opponents, ranked Season Ladder with five divisions, the Draft Mode known as The Gauntlet, and spectator-enabled in-game Tournaments.

Featuring distinct and strikingly beautiful character designs and game environments created by lead artists Glauber Kotaki (Rogue Legacy) and Christophe Ha (Overwatch, World of Warcraft, Diablo III) and a veteran game design team, including creative director and producer Keith Lee (Diablo III, Ratchet & Clank) and distinguished board game designer Eric Lang (XCOM, Blood Rage, Dice Masters, Warhammer, Game of Thrones, The Others: 7 Sins).

Atlas Reactor Releases HTC Vive Virtual Reality Preview

Posted: 05 Apr 2016 02:32 PM PDT

Trion Worlds has produced an interactive VR exploration of the characters in its latest game, Atlas Reactor, available April 5th on Steam for the HTC Vive, the virtual reality headset jointly created by HTC and Valve. The experience will be freely downloadable, bringing you face-to-face with the current lineup of Atlas Reactor's Freelancers – dynamic, larger-than-life heroes, each with their own unique abilities, roles, and personalities.

The VR experience built by Trion's virtual reality lab showcases Atlas' most wanted Freelancers in a revolutionary new way.  Perched atop one of the many skyscrapers in the game's cloud-piercing cityscape, users will get an up-close look at Atlas Reactor's full character roster. They can watch Freelancers perform in-game abilities and taunts, in addition to previewing each character's visual customization options, like skins and styles, with the wave of a hand.

"We believe in the promise of VR," said Scott Hartsman, CEO of Trion Worlds. "The kinds of experiences that VR will be able to deliver speaks to the core of why many of us got into making connected worlds and games in the first place. We're thrilled to be here for the first generation of devices that will truly begin to deliver on some of that amazing promise. We know there’s a long road ahead before millions of people have these and we want to be here creating experiences for you every step of the way. For now, we hope early VR adopters have some fun with this token of our high esteem for VR, and we salute all the other developers creating great experiences this early in its life."

En Masse Releases TERA Rewards Program

Posted: 05 Apr 2016 01:55 PM PDT

En Masse Entertainment today released a new system into TERA known as TERA Rewards. Akin to rival Blade & Soul’s system, TERA Rewards offers players tiers to progress through from either completing end-game Vanguard Requests or spending EMP in the TERA store. As a player progressing through the tiers, new and improved items will become available, along with other bonuses! There’s 10 tiers in all.

As a means to test the new system out, all current TERA players will receive an initial grant of reward points and reward credits based on a number of factors, including how many level 65 characters they have, the length of time they have had elite status subscriptions, the amount of EMP they've spent, and whether they have a Founder's account.

League of Legends Patch Notes 6.7 + Taric Rework

Posted: 05 Apr 2016 01:33 PM PDT

One of the OG champions, League of Legends has long promised a revisit to the Gem Knight Taric. Now at last that wait is almost over, as Taric has been reborn with a new kit, new audio, new lore, and improved flowing hair! He’s playable now on the public beta environment but below you can catch his abilities.

Passive: Bravado
Taric infuses his next two basic attacks whenever he casts an ability. He swings faster with these two attacks, which deal increased damage and reduce his cooldowns.
Q: Starlight's Touch
Taric heals himself and all nearby allies based on the number of Starlight’s Touch charges he's stored. Taric generates up to three charges over time.
W: Bastion
All of Taric's abilities are simultaneously cast from both Taric and his linked ally.

Passive: Bastion increases Taric's armor.

Active: Taric links with an ally, shielding them from damage. Bastion remains on Taric's ally until he recasts it onto another ally, or the two move far enough apart to break their link.

E: Dazzle
After a brief delay, Taric fires out a short wave of celestial energy in a target direction that stuns all enemies struck.
R: Cosmic Radiance
Taric calls on the stars themselves for protection. After a moderate delay, he and all nearby allies become invulnerable for a few seconds.
